POINTS OF UNITY
At Coop Gallery, we are a collective of artists and community members who believe in creating a space where everyone can thrive creatively, personally, and collectively. We welcome people of all backgrounds and experiences, and while our stories may differ, we unite on the following shared values:
Collaboration: We work together, valuing each other’s input and ideas, and fostering creative partnerships that challenge and uplift.
Inclusivity & Safety: We are committed to building a space where all feel welcome, seen, and safe, particularly those from historically marginalized communities.
Honesty & Respect: We communicate openly and transparently, treating each other with respect and care. We believe in accountability and integrity in all interactions.
Community & Participation: We show up for one another, building a supportive community where participation and presence matter. We believe that growth happens through mutual encouragement.
Learning & Repair: We are a learning community, open to evolving and growing through dialogue and reflection. We embrace the challenge of repair, especially in the face of harm, and prioritize restorative actions.
Anti-Racism: We actively stand against racism and all forms of oppression, striving to dismantle systemic inequities within our gallery space and beyond.
Openness & Communication: We believe in discussing matters before taking action, fostering a culture where assumptions are replaced by understanding. Thoughtful conversation is key to our process.
Through these points of unity, Coop Gallery seeks to cultivate an environment where creativity, growth, and solidarity can flourish. Together, we build, we learn, and we care for each other.
